Kingdom of calm and style in the heart of New York: cream-colored interiors of Manhattan townhouse

Someone loves colorful and bold interiors (we posted a bright family home in London earlier today), but there are also those who want peace and tranquility when coming home. Especially given the incredibly intense rhythm of life in modern cities. This townhouse is located in the heart of New York in Manhattan, close to the financial center and bustling tourist streets, but its interiors have become a quiet oasis for its owners. The space is decorated in a monochrome palette of cream shades that create the effect of softness, warmth and comfort. The furniture is modern and elegant, many pieces are inspired by Scandinavian design and upholstered in boucle style. Interestingly, the house was designed for a young family with a child (the nursery is very cute!), despite the light colors and minimalist design.
